Simptomi
Iedomājieties šādu scenāriju:
-
Iespējojiet izsekošanas karodziņu (TF) 7412 programmā Microsoft SQL Server 2016 vai 2017.
-
Jums ir sesija N, kur tiek izpildīta komanda , kas atjaunina pamata indeksu, un tiek ģenerēts arī trūkstošs alfabētiskā rādītāja brīdinājums.
-
No sesijas M palaidiet dinamiskās pārvaldības funkcijas (DMFA) sys.dm_exec_query_statistics_xml (N) , kas norāda uz sesiju n.
Šajā situācijā, iespējams, pamanīsit, ka komanda ir bloķēta ar gaidīšanas tipa QRY_PROFILE_LIST_MUTEX, DMFA nevar izpildīt izpildi, un abas sesijas šķiet karājamies.
Risinājums
Informācija par servisa pakotnes SQL Server 2016
Šī problēma ir novērsta šajā SQL Server servisa pakotnē:
Pakalpojumu pakotnes ir kumulatīvas. Katrā jaunajā servisa pakotnē ir iekļauti visi labojumi, kas ir iepriekšējās servisa pakotnēs, kā arī visi jaunie labojumi. Mūsu ieteikums ir lietot jaunāko servisa pakotni un jaunāko šīs servisa pakotnes kumulatīvo atjauninājumu. Pirms jaunākās servisa pakotnes instalēšanas jums nav jāinstalē iepriekšējā servisa pakotne. Tālāk esošajā rakstā Izmantojiet 1. tabulu, lai atrastu papildinformāciju par jaunāko servisa pakotni un jaunāko kumulatīvo atjauninājumu.
Kā noteikt SQL Server un tās komponentu versiju, izdevumu un atjaunināšanas līmeni
Šī problēma ir novērsta šajā SQL Server kumulatīvajā atjauninājumā:
Katrs jaunais kumulatīvais SQL Server atjauninājums ietver visus labojumfailus un drošības labojumus, kas bija iepriekšējā būvējumā. Ieteicams instalēt jaunāko būvējumu savai SQL Server versijai:
Statusa
Microsoft ir apstiprinājusi, ka šī problēma pastāv Microsoft produktos, kas ir norādīti sadaļā "attiecas uz".
Atsauces
Uzziniet par terminoloģiju, ko Microsoft izmanto, lai aprakstītu programmatūras atjauninājumus.